有时候我们需要替换字符串中的一部分,同时保留其中的转义符。这就需要使用正则表达式来匹配特殊字符,并进行相应的替换操作。 示例代码如下所示: importjava.util.regex.Matcher;importjava.util.regex.Pattern;Stringstr="Hello\tWorld!";// 字符串中包含制表符Stringpattern="\\t";// 匹配制表符的正则表达式Pattern...
字符常量使用单引号('')括起来的单个字符,涵盖世界上所有书面语的字符。例如:char c1 = 'a' ; char c2 = '中'; char c3 = '9'; (字符: 用英文的单引号括起来的字母,数字,符号) Java中还允许使用转义字符 ''来将其后面的字符转变为特殊字符常量。例如: char c3 = '\n' // '\n' 表示换行符 c...
Fastjson是一个Java库,它可以方便地将Java对象序列化为JSON格式的字符串,也可以将JSON字符串反序列化为Java对象。Fastjson的性能非常高,是阿里巴巴开源的一个JSON处理库。 问题描述 在某些情况下,我们需要将Java对象转换成JSON字符串,但是希望保留字符串中的转义字符。例如,我们有一个Java对象User,其中包含一个descriptio...